Arizona to face Purdue in Foster Farms Bowl

The Wildcats are headed to Santa Clara

The Arizona Wildcats will be taking on the Purdue Boilermakers in the Foster Farms Bowl at Levi’s Stadium in Santa Clara, Calif., it was announced Sunday.

The game is scheduled for 6:30 p.m. MST on Wednesday, Dec. 27. It will be televised on FOX. Levi’s Stadium is the home of the NFL’s San Francisco 49ers.

Purdue went 6-6 this season and 4-5 in the Big Ten, good for fourth place in the West division. This is Arizona’s first time playing a Big Ten team in a bowl game.

Arizona is 0-2 all-time against the Boilermakers with the last matchup coming in 2005 when the Wildcats lost to No. 12 Purdue 31-24 in Tucson.

Purdue is the No. 41 team in the S&P+ ratings, while Arizona is No. 49. Those ratings peg the Boilermakers to have the No. 73 offense in the country, No. 28 defense, and No. 83 special teams.

The Wildcats have the No. 9 offense, No. 114 defense, and No. 95 special teams.

Most believed Arizona was going to be playing in the Las Vegas Bowl, but that was likely nixed when the Washington Huskies fell 11th in the College Football Playoff standings, allowing them to play in a New Year’s Six bowl and subsequently moving the Wildcats up the Pac-12 bowl tie-in list.
